Pitch Pine Floorboards
ref. - 2004
Original Pitch Pine flooring salvaged from the Army Reserve Centre in Dunfermline, Fife. The building was once used as drill halls during World War I, meaning the boards date back to at least 1914. They are incredibly robust, boasting a 30mm thickness. There are occasional white badminton court markings on the face which can be removed when sanded. The images show the boards in their salvaged condition and after sanding with a hard wax oil finish.
